软件系统安全检测
软件系统安全检测,旨在确保软件系统的安全性,防止潜在的安全漏洞和攻击。
这个检测过程中,常见的检测手段,如漏洞扫描、渗透测试、静态代码分析、安全配置检查等是非常必要的。
漏洞扫描:使用自动化工具对软件系统进行扫描,以发现潜在的安全漏洞。这些工具基于已知的漏洞数据库进行扫描,并报告任何发现的漏洞。
渗透测试:模拟黑客的行为,尝试通过各种手段获取未授权的访问权限,以评估软件系统的安全性。渗透测试通常由专业的安全团队进行,并可能包括社会工程学等手段。
静态代码分析:通过对软件系统的源代码进行分析,检查是否存在潜在的安全问题,如缓冲区溢出、未初始化的变量等。
动态分析:在软件运行过程中进行分析,观察其行为并检测可能的安全问题。这可以通过插桩、模糊测试等技术实现。
安全配置检查:验证软件系统的安全配置是否正确,例如检查防火墙规则、访问控制列表等。
在进行软件系统安全检测时,还需注意以下几点:
确保测试环境与实际生产环境尽可能一致,以便更准确地模拟和检测潜在的安全问题。
定期对软件进行安全更新和补丁,以修复已知的安全漏洞。
如企业没有配备专业的测试环境,建议联系专业的安全团队来执行测试,确保软件系统的安全性。
腾创实验室(广州)有限公司是信息安全和网络解决方案提供商之一,提供包括软件安全检测在内的多种安全服务,拥有先进的技术和丰富的经验。腾创实验室(广州)有限公司已获得广东省市场监督管理局检验检测机构资质认定证书(CMA)、中国合格评定国家认可认可证书(CNAS)和信息安全服务认证书(CCRC),具备为企业提供安全测评的资格和能力,欢迎来电咨询。
steccn.cn.b2b168.com/m/